Madylin Sweeten: From Ally Barone to Advocate and Artist

The Girl Who Stole Our Hearts

Madylin Sweeten captured the hearts of audiences worldwide with her portrayal of Ally Barone, the witty and precocious daughter on the beloved sitcom Everybody Loves Raymond. Born on June 27, 1991, in Brownwood, Texas, Madylin began her acting career at a tender age. By the time she was four, she had already appeared in the television movie A Promise to Carolyn and several commercials in Dallas. Her big break came when she was cast as Ally Barone, the eldest child of Ray and Debra Barone, on the CBS sitcom that aired from 1996 to 2005.


Early Life and Family

Madylin is the eldest of four children born to Timothy Lynn “Tim” Sweeten and Elizabeth Anne Gini. She has two younger twin brothers, Sawyer and Sullivan Sweeten, who also appeared on Everybody Loves Raymond as Geoffrey and Michael Barone, respectively. Tragically, her brother Sawyer passed away in 2015 at the age of 19. This loss profoundly impacted Madylin, leading her to become a vocal advocate for mental health awareness and suicide prevention.


Career Highlights

After Everybody Loves Raymond concluded, Madylin continued to pursue acting. She appeared in films such as Eagle Eye (2008) and Spare Change (2015). Additionally, she made guest appearances on television series including Grey’s Anatomy, Lucifer, and Dirty John. Her versatility as an actress allowed her to transition from sitcoms to more dramatic roles with ease.

Beyond acting, Madylin has been involved in theater. She is a board member of the Los Angeles theater company Loft Ensemble, where she has also directed, worked in production, and done set design. The company is known for its focus on young voices and inventive productions, including horror plays and unique interpretations of Shakespearean works.


Entrepreneurship and Artistic Ventures

Madylin’s creativity extends beyond the screen and stage. She pursued a degree in interior design from the Fashion Institute of Design and Merchandising. Through her website, she sells her art printed on various items, including t-shirts, hats, and backpacks. This entrepreneurial venture showcases her multifaceted talents and passion for design.

Personal Life

Madylin married Sean Durrie on August 31, 2018. In 2025, the couple welcomed their first child, a son, marking a new chapter in their lives.
